- 520 __ |a About The Secret Psychology of How We Fall in Love A scientifically proven 9-step program for understanding the dating brain and finding the love of your life Psychiatrist Paul Dobransky presents a patented, clinically proven, easy-to-follow nine-step program that can lead to lasting love. Successful romantic relationships have three phases: 1. Attraction 2. Bonding in friendship 3. Commitment Dr. Dobransky demonstrates how each of these stages is dealt with by a particular part of the brain.
